WebSep 16, 2024 · Every month, you will receive more money on your food stamps card. The amount is determined by several factors, including how much money you make and how many people are in your household. You can spend the money on eligible food items. If you don’t spend it all, the remaining amount will roll over to the next month. WebSNAP Eligibility Calculator. WebAug 15, 2024 · In order to qualify for a food stamp or EBT card, you must meet certain income and asset guidelines. Income Guidelines. In order to qualify for food stamps, your household income must be at or below 130% of the federal poverty level. For a family of four, this means an annual income of $32,630 or less. WebFood and Nutrition Services is a federal food assistance program that provides low-income families the food they need for a nutritionally adequate diet. Benefits are issued via Electronic Benefit Transfer cards (EBT cards). There are three ways to apply for Food and Nutrition Services (Food Stamps): Apply online with ePASS.

Pandemic EBT (P-EBT) is a temporary program that gives food assistance benefits to eligible families during the federal COVID-19 public health emergency. The benefits are given on a card called an EBT card, which works like a debit card. You can use it to buy food at stores that accept EBT cards. phone dundee city councilWebCheck SNAP and cash assistance account balances; Report that an EBT card has been lost or stolen; Report that the EBT card does not work; and.
